Output 35005fa0b9dfd18b5f872a2526f120e7a05c1adf0dea499862ad5d99c91b1bdd:6

value
136400000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ac2c2263903c3a005cdfe49c79914c5d4301ace3 OP_EQUAL
address
3HPP23c2r7BxnE5ksydq1AbETEe6hhMVUJ
transaction
35005fa0b9dfd18b5f872a2526f120e7a05c1adf0dea499862ad5d99c91b1bdd
confirmations
465357
spent
true